If anyone is searching for 454 headers in 2020 (my 345 may need replacements, the original ones were installed in 1989), Doug Thorley still makes them. They're listed as "Out of Stock", but they are still made. Need to plan ahead though. It could take 8 weeks to get into their production schedule.
